The Arizona Wildcats (43-19) defeated the North Carolina Tar Heels in the second game of the Chapel Hill Super Regional at North Carolina on June 7.
After a pair of walks, UNC brought in left-hander Folger Boaz to face left-handed-hitting Maddox Mihalakis. Mihalakis lined the first pitch he saw into right-center for a two-RBI single to restore Arizona’s two-run lead.
Maddox Mihalakis knocked a go-ahead single in the seventh inning, and Arizona defeated North Carolina on Saturday, forcing a deciding game in the Chapel Hill Super Regional.
The Wildcats swept through the Eugene Regional to earn their trip to Chapel Hill. Arizona dominated Cal Poly, winning 14-0 in the regional-clinching game, with center field Aaron Walton hitting three home runs and driving in six runs.
